The Raspberry Pi is a rather trendy little computer - nonetheless unlike regular desktop computers it does not come preloaded with an operating system (OS). This means that in order to utilize the Raspberry Pi computer you should install a OS of your choice onto a SD card as well as use that too the computer system.

This post will certainly show how to mount an operating system, blink it to a SD card and also boot your Raspberry Pi for the very first time.

If you wish to comply with the article in the house you have to have:

A Raspberry Pi - Design B
A SD Card (minutes. 2 GB).
A computer with a net connection and a SD card viewers.
A USB keyboard.
A HDMI monitor.
Selecting an Operating System (OS).

A Raspberry Pi does not run common os such as Windows 8 or OS X. This is since the Raspberry Pi is powered by a so-called ARM processor, this kind of computer cpu can not carry out the exact same programs as your computer system. Rather it must run among the operating systems that have been optimized as well as ported to the Raspbery Pi ARM equipment style.

Thankfully there are plenty of various operating systems available. It is essential to note that most of them are based upon the linux kernel.

Soft-float Debian "wheezy".

The soft-float debian os is made use of largely if you are running intensive java based applications on your Raspberry Pi (We wont be doing that in the meantime).

Arch Linux ARM.

This os is except beginners so we wont talk even more concerning it recently. However you need to take a better take a look at this if you are already a knowledgeable Linux individual.

Raspbian "Wheezy".

The Raspbian "Wheezy" running system is the most popular operating system to run on the Raspberry Pi. It has very good assimilation with the hardware and comes pre-loaded with a graphical user interface and development devices. This will certainly come in extremely handy if you are not also experienced in a linux atmosphere.

For the objective of this post we will utilize the Raspbian os since it is easy to start with. Very first step is download the most recent variation of the Raspbian "Wheezy" operating system picture. It is easily readily available below (scroll to "Raw Images").

As soon as you have actually downloaded and move the file to a proper folder right click and select "Essence All ..." - this will draw out the picture data from the downloaded zip file.

Other Devices.

In addition to the os we are also going to need a program that can transfer the operating system to our SD card as though the Raspberry Pi can use it too from. This program is called Win32DiskImager as well as is readily available here free of charge.

Beginning Win32DiskImager.

Once you have actually downloaded the Win32DiskImager documents - move it to a proper folder, right-click and also choose "Essence All ..." adhere to the overview to extract the program.

The program does not require to be installed - you can start it now by double clicking the data "Win32DiskImager". Before starting plug the vacant SD card right into your computer.

As soon as started you will need to choose the Rasbian "Wheezy" picture file, next select the drive letter of your SD card.

KEEP IN MIND: Its vital that you are 100% sure that the drive letter picked is your SD card.

Currently press "Create" as well as unwind and kick back while the program sets up the operating system onto your SD card. While waiting you can link the Raspberry Pi to a USB Keyboard & Computer Mouse as well as a HDMI screen or TV.

First boot.

As soon as we have actually set the SD Card - connect it right into the Raspberry Pi. At this point whatever but the power supply ought to be linked into the Raspberry Pi.

First Boot Arrangement.

Attach power as well as you ought to see the boot series on your TV (otherwise check if you selected right HDMI input on TELEVISION). After initial boot the Raspberry Pi boots up in arrangement mode. If it does not boot into configuration setting you can kind the following command to arrive:.

sudo raspi-config.
When in configuration mode we intend to:.

Re-size to file-system to utilize the whole SD card in my instance (4GB) (First option in configuration food selection).
Change the area to match your area (This is discovered under "Internationalization Options").
Adjustment the timezone to match your location (This is located under "Internationalization Options").
We can currently reboot the raspberry and also when it boots once more it will come up with our new setup! To log in usage the complying with credentials:.

User: pi.
Password: raspberry.
Your Raspberry is currently configuration, set up and also prepared for you to utilize for any objective you want.
